Paya Resak in Marang, Terengganu recorded 3 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M 410K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 134.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 410K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 373K to RM 420K, and a typical market range of RM 375K to RM 420K.

Most transactions involved 1 - 1 1/2 storey semi-detached, with moderate diversity in property types available.

For price per square foot, the median is RM 134, with most transactions between RM 127 and RM 141. The usual range is RM 112.63 to RM 155.38,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M 42.75 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M 7 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
